With a "Mission Metallica" website set up at http://missionmetallica.com/ promising fans "Experience the album... before it's done" it looks as though Amazon.com have let slip the US release date by prematurely listing the album for pre-ordering before release on the 28th October 2008.

Album Information

Title: Death Magnetic
By: Metallica
October 2008

Track Listing:
  1. That Was Just Your Life
  2. The End Of The Line
  3. Broken, Beat & Scarred
  4. The Day That Never Comes
  5. All Nightmare Long
  6. Cyanide
  7. The Unforgiven III
  8. The Judas Kiss
  9. Suicide & Redemption
  10. My Apocalypse
